01 / A USEFUL CONSIDERATION
Set a clear inspection question
An inspection for recurring blockages may have a different scope from documenting an accessible route. Explain what decision the inspection is intended to support.
02 / A USEFUL CONSIDERATION
Check access and visibility
Inspection openings, pipe conditions and obstructions affect camera access. Cleaning may be recommended to improve visibility before a condition review.
03 / A USEFUL CONSIDERATION
Ask for an explanation of the findings
Footage is more useful when the visible issue and its location are explained. Ask what is known and what cannot be established from the inspection alone.
04 / A USEFUL CONSIDERATION
Use the report to plan the next step
Retain the footage and notes. If repairs are proposed, compare the recommended scope against the inspection findings and the access needed.
